Vucic: The Croatian Minister of Foreign Affairs interferes in the Internal Affairs of Serbia

Published February 25, 2024
Share
SHARE

Serbian President Aleksandar Vučić said that Croatian Foreign Minister Gordan Grlić Radman “brutally interferes in Serbia’s internal affairs”.

“Grlić-Radman is right about one thing, maybe I am someone’s Trabant, maybe a “Wartburg”, maybe a “fica”, but I have never been anyone’s errand and servant, which cannot be said for Grlić-Radman. Let me not go too far in the past, it would have been too painful…”, wrote Vučić on “Instagram”.

Grlić Radman said yesterday that Serbia must decide on whose chair it will sit.

“It is uncomfortable to sit on two chairs. He should not have a big dilemma. Vučić can be a Trabant and a satellite of Russia, but he will not allow the influence of the Russians or other malignant influences that would undermine the stability of the Western Balkans,” Grlić Radman said.
